Quoting Teddicus
Entries at .86, .91, .03....

Hey Gepp... I'm curious about your MM.... you mentioned a few posts ago that your building a smaller account into an account where you don't run into margin issues... so I am curious how risky you get?
I'm not sure I recall saying that.

Anyway, I like to "scale into" trades, starting with a small piece of the overall position I want to get in and then work it up to half or so what I want. Once things start going my way, I tend to add aggressively while keeping a tight leash on things.

It's definitely an aggressive style, and not for everyone. If you can master it, you can make a killing. The other year, I took a $4,000 account to over $50,000 in five weeks. I like to pyramid, and I see nothing wrong with that strategy if you know how to add to your winners and keep your SLs in order.

I'm not arguing this down move isn't corrective.

*cough* *cough, Bob* *cough*

I believe that's the case, but I think there's more correction yet to come. Check out the daily and look back to Jan 8th and 23rd (I think those are the dates... hard to see on my phone's charts).

The 139-140 zone was major support back then. The last few days have managed to hack through that area and now guess what? We're testing it as resistance.

If I had gambled longs at the bottom, I'd be taking profits here now and getting short.

This correction may or may not be done. But either way, I've seen enough corrections to know how they end: in days of very boring consolidation where all the noobs finally buy into bearish sentiment and start shorting, waiting for the next big drop, while all the vets start building longs for the next move up.

Basically, there will be plenty of time to get long after the correction is over. I don't think that time has come, but if we haven't broken lower in the next couple days, I'm probably wrong.
